2015-08-03 7 views
5

Ich habe Probleme beim Hochladen einer App mit diesem Framework in eine App.FEHLER ITMS-90207 Ungültiges Paket

ERROR ITMS-90207 „Ungültige Bundle. Das Bündel an .../TesseractOCR.framework‘ enthält kein Bündel ausführbar.

In meinem Xcodeproj habe ich ein anderes Projekt nach innen, i bin Rahmen auf Abhängigkeiten verknüpften Bibliotheken und Kopieren von Dateien einschließlich.

Sie etwas über dieses Thema ?. wissen Sie

Vielen Dank, Nahuel.

Antwort

0

Ich löste das, indem ich Mach-O Typ in Dynamische Bibliothek in Build-Einstellungen änderte. Xcode erzeugte keine ausführbare Datei.

+1

Es ist nicht für mich arbeiten .... –

0

Ich löste es, indem ich Bitcode abstellte. (Unter zwei sind bezogenen Einstellungen)

  1. Build-Einstellungen> Optionen Erstellen> Bitcode aktivieren: NEIN
  2. Uncheck "Include Bitcode", wenn App Itunes Connect Upload (nach der Archivierung)
+0

Auch das für mich gearbeitet, aber auf Kosten der App kommt nicht für das Zielgerät optimiert ... –

+0

Dies ist nicht für mich arbeiten. Könnten Sie mir bitte eine andere Einstellung vorschlagen, die mir vielleicht fehlt? Danke –

2

Ich hatte Dasselbe Problem. Ich das Problem behoben, indem Sie dieses Verfahren:

In Ihrer info.plist Datei unter dem Schlüssel Ausführbare Datei, fügen Sie den Wert $(EXECUTABLE_NAME).

+0

das hat nicht funktioniert !!! – Swati

Verwandte Themen